Attorney-at-Law Gunaratne Wanninayake arrived at the Mount Lavinia Police Station this morning.Police Media Spokesperson ASP F. U. Wootler stated that he came to provide a statement along with a witness.On the 15th of October, Wanninayake appeared before the Mount Lavinia Court and was released on two sureties of Rs. 500,000 each.Police had presented several allegations against him in court, including obstructing the duties of a police officer, stemming from an incident that took place at the Mount Lavinia Court premises.
